Subject: FD leak hunt — context

Welcome aboard. The Perchline ingest daemon leaks file descriptors under retry storms; we hit ulimit twice last month. Suspect the TLS wrapper in the fetch pool. Capture lsof snapshots every 10 minutes during your shift and attach them to the tracking ticket. Full triage notes and graphs live on the internal page here.

runbook for tafof-yawif: https://confluence.tolvaqsys.internal/display/display/browse/pages/7be3

Fan-out backpressure behaves differently in each. Dev has no throttling; staging applies soft limits with logging only; prod enforces hard limits and will shed low-priority plugin notifications under load. Plugin authors: test against staging, since prod queue depth caps will silently drop bursts above the threshold. Shed events are visible in the delivery ledger with reason codes. Retry semantics are identical across environments. Each environment's backpressure parameters are set via the values shown below.

settings of tagef-bawif:
DRUIX_HOST=druix.zemvarlabs.internal
DRUIX_PORT=8000

Runbook: Scanline barcode bridge

If warehouse scans stop flowing into Cartwheel, it's almost always the bridge service on the Dunmore floor box wedging after a USB hiccup. Bounce the service first — nine times out of ten that fixes it. If not, check the queue depth before escalating. When restarting, make sure the bridge comes up with these settings.

deployment values, yafop-bajef:
[gilok]
team = ulaius
access_code = ac_423664
host = gilok.sivrelhq.corp
port = 9200
owner = pelius.istax
peer = eliok.torvasoft.internal

FINANCE REVIEW — LEASE RENEGOTIATION

Summary for finance. The Bramwell Court lease expires in ten months. Landlord opened at a 14% increase; we countered flat with a two-year extension. Current position: 5% uplift, improvement allowance included. Annualized savings versus market relocation: significant, given fit-out costs at comparable sites in Ostermere. Recommend acceptance pending legal review of the assignment clause. Decision needed by month-end to preserve terms. Strategic context is provided in the confidential note below.

board note of kajeg-bahof: Holdorix Works plans to lower the Briius list price by 11.6 percent in September. The pricing group signed off on a budget of $499.9 million for Project Holdor. The renewal with Fraokix Group closes at $129.5 million a year, 50.2 percent above the last contract. Project Tameth slips by one quarter because of the tooling delay.